California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) in the USA has issued a request for proposal (RFP) seeking a financial adviser to evaluate and recommend various financing alternatives for transportation projects. The adviser will provide specialized financial services to the Department on issues relating, but not limited to, transportation bond and loan projects such as GARVEE bonds and TIFIA loans, Public-Private Partnerships (P3), Public-Public Partnerships projects, tolling projects to ensure the successful implementation of these programs.

The scope of works for the consultant is as follows:

  • develop, evaluate, and recommend various financing alternatives to advance transportation projects as directed by the Department
  • Written assessments of feasibility, risk, credit, and fiscal policy implications of each financing alternative being considered
  • Informing the Department in writings, or by other agreed-upon means, of current and historical finance trends and issues
  • Providing information on other major national, state, and local transportation financing issues and make recommendations
  • Providing timely consultation, when requested, including meeting with and making presentations to other involved entities, both through teleconferencing and face-to-face meetings
